Commercial Description:
Intriguing doses of sweet spices, dark cocoa and pumpkin transform an exceptional porter into a mesmerizing potion. Pour this tantalizing brew into a snifter and seek solace in the depths of its darkness. Cinnamon, cloves and nutmeg seem familiar, but this brew’s deep dark secrets will forever haunt you.

Bottle and served in my Bells snifter: Deep brown with some reddish highlights, fading fizzy head and spotty lace. Wow, they did not skimp on the pumpkin or spices for sure, lovely combination of pumpkin and chocolate cream pie aroma. Even a hint of pipe tobacco and earthy yeast esters thrown about for extra fun and enjoyment. The taste is equally spicy, earthy and porter like. The chocolate and sweet malts are easy to find wrapped around all that pumpkin pie like flavors. The mouth feel is smooth and round but the finish is a bit ashy. Overall a damn solid brew and quite tasty. Mikey Likey this even more than Flossmoor’s Big Black Pumpkin.
